Foundation Pouring in Columbus, OH
Foundation pouring services involve the process of creating a stable and durable base for new structures or for repairs to existing foundations. This service is essential for a variety of projects, including building new homes, additions, garages, or commercial buildings, as well as addressing issues like settling or cracking in existing foundations. Property owners typically want to understand the types of foundation materials used, the methods of pouring, and how the process ensures long-term stability and support for their structures.
Before requesting foundation pouring services, homeowners should consider factors such as the soil conditions on their property, the scope of the project, and any specific structural requirements. It’s also helpful to know if permits are needed and what preparations are necessary before work begins. Clear communication about project goals and site conditions can help ensure the foundation is designed and poured to meet the property's needs effectively.

Common Foundation Pouring Jobs
Foundation Pouring - Essential for creating a stable base for new construction or additions.
Basement Foundations - Provides a strong, level foundation for basement spaces.
Slab Foundations - Ideal for ground-level structures like garages and patios.
Retaining Wall Foundations - Supports retaining walls to prevent soil erosion and shifting.
Pier and Beam Foundations - Elevates structures to protect against moisture and flooding.
Foundation Repairs - Addresses cracks or settling to maintain structural integrity.
Foundation Pouring Questions
What types of foundation pouring projects are common? Foundation pouring is often used for new home construction, additions, basement floors, and repair work on existing foundations.
How should property owners prepare for foundation pouring? Clear the area of obstacles, ensure proper drainage, and provide access for equipment to facilitate the process.
What materials are typically used in foundation pouring? Concrete is the primary material, often reinforced with steel rebar or wire mesh for added strength.
What factors influence the choice of foundation type? Soil conditions, property size, building design, and load requirements are key considerations in selecting the appropriate foundation.
